To help celebrate National Health Information Management Week ( ), Rural Health West would like to acknowledge the amazing work our Data Analytics Team does.
Rural Health West has been collecting data about the WA rural health workforce since the 1990s. Every year we survey general practitioners, health professionals, medical specialists, practices and health organisations about their experiences, concerns and current trends.
Our data team has a combined 40 years of experience analysing and interpreting workforce data. They channel the insights they generate into workforce reporting, research and program development.
The theme for this year is "Trusted information, smarter decisions, stronger communities," highlighting the essential role of health data and information management professionals in driving safe and connected healthcare.
Our Annual Workforce Update highlights practitioner numbers, geographic distribution, working hours, and retention challenges, and celebrated its 25th publication this year.
